Original Patched with 1.112fm
Filename: DeusEx.exe
Filesize: 248 KB (253,952 bytes)
CRC-32: 761380b5
MD4: 697930e80696fac68fb1d23740a076fd
MD5: 795137104d97da1bf4282fd6979bb38d
SHA-1: 2a933e26aa9cfb33b37f78afe21434caa031f14a
Hanfling's
Filename: DeusEx.exe
Filesize: 232 KB (237,568 bytes)
CRC-32: 3b57c567
MD4: f36c07ad1b9814aa2e37e291b22607bf
MD5: ee96b5489871e34a74e9348c095499b6
SHA-1: 3109fdd0e691f57ac8d564e5b03a8952b45a2369
Kentie's 4.3.0.0
Filename: DeusEx.exe
Filesize: 508 KB (520,192 bytes)
CRC-32: 51977a6c
MD4: fe986a109259222ce51b0952cf390317
MD5: 9e31c608f2141fb6a51f0f307befadd3
SHA-1: cf31aaf0f0cd3ead52e968bf20c52efcfd777f5b
Kentie's 5.3.0.0
Filename: Revision.exe
Filesize: 385 KB (394,752 bytes)
CRC-32: 9893c7e1
MD4: acb6342d54255b7b96c02ce4ed4f0047
MD5: 4e6cf17c7ce1392953d7bb6067e585b9
SHA-1: 5e7169b85c5c474a487f57329eb506e220f62455
Steam Goty
Filename: DeusEx.exe
Filesize: 62.5 KB (64,000 bytes)
CRC-32: 4bc3d630
MD4: c6d7e788f07036f5f666309e02d47188
MD5: 1cd6f5a2e7ddd95d931fd42f238c3813
SHA-1: af951ddd35b38e8d9cc8501b8a50a02a3ab6cae7
Unknown custom
Filename: CustomDeusEx.exe
Filesize: 228 KB (233,472 bytes)
CRC-32: 6232a03a
MD4: 211b02f8777e622359b94ff60a02809c
MD5: 8d4db1462032cf8c890fb33d54adca39
SHA-1: 4cf543a908e7a5fa15e2d8bbbefdf6aa4270a5ff
